Meet China of Sebastian, FL
China is a beautiful 11 year old female and she weighs 22 pounds.  She was surrendered to Eskie Rescuers United with her 10 year old sister, India. While it would be nice to keep the sisters together, they dont appear to be terribly bonded to one another.  India is the alpha and dominates with her outgoing personality.  We think China would also be happy in a quieter home with another calmer and more submissive dog, or even being in her very own home.
China is fairly active and is good with other dogs.  She is very sweet and friendly, though a little reserved, and enjoys the company of older kids.  She has not been cat tested, but her previous owner said that she and India would likely find chasing a cat to be great fun. China is in very good health.
